4. 给出针对Linux错误码2的排查和解决方法 排查步骤: 检查文件或目录路径:确认提供的文件或目录路径是否正确,包括所有必要的目录层级。 检查文件或目录是否存在:使用ls、dir等命令查看文件或目录是否存在。 检查当前用户权限:确保当前用户有权访问目标文件或目录。
–1:通常表示一般性的未知错误。 –2:通常表示命令调用错误,即命令不存在或无法执行。 –126:表示命令无法执行,可能是因为没有执行权限。 –127:表示命令不存在。 –128:表示命令因为收到了一个信号而终止。 –130:表示命令被Ctrl+C终止。 – 其他的错误码可以根据不同的命令进行解释。 3. 在脚本中使用返回值...
1. 1错误码:一般表示未知命令或无效的命令行参数。 2. 2错误码:一般表示无法找到指定的文件或目录。 3. 126错误码:一般表示禁止执行,权限不足或无法执行脚本。 4. 127错误码:一般表示命令未找到。 5. 128错误码:一般表示无效的退出参数或信号。 6. 130错误码:一般表示命令被中断。 7. 255错误码:一般表示...
errno139 : Unknown error 139 错误码对应宏 由上可见Linux对错误宏的定义。 头文件 /usr/include/asm-generic/errno-base.h 的源码: #ifndef _ASM_GENERIC_ERRNO_BASE_H #define _ASM_GENERIC_ERRNO_BASE_H #define EPERM 1 /* Operation not permitted */ #define ENOENT2 /* No such file or director...
linux系统错误码⼤全#define EPERM 1 /* Operation not permitted */ #define ENOENT 2 /* No such file or directory */ #define ESRCH 3 /* No such process */ #define EINTR 4 /* Interrupted system call */ #define EIO 5 /* I/O error */ #define ENXIO...
Linux 中系统调用的错误都存储于错误码 errno 中。errno 由操作系统维护,存储就近发生的错误,即下一次的错误码会覆盖掉上一次的错误。 errno 是一个包含在 <errno.h> 中的预定义的外部 int 变量,用于表示最近一个函数调用是否产生了错误。 若为0,则无错误; ...
Linux操作系统错误码列表 error code list,OSerrorcode1:OperationnotpermittedOSerrorcode2:NosuchfileordirectoryOSerrorcode3:NosuchprocessOSerrorcode4:InterruptedsystemcallOSerrorcode5:Input/outp...
Linux错误码大全(建议收藏).pdf,Linux 错误码大全 查看错误代码 errno 是调试程序的一个重要方法。当 linuc C api 函数发 生异常时 ,一般会将 errno 变量 (需 include errno.h) 赋一个整数值 ,不同的 值表示不同的含义 ,可以通过查看该值推测出错的原因。在实际编程中用 这
errno 2 在Linux 系统中表示 "No such file or directory"(没有这样的文件或目录)。这是一个常见的错误码,当进程试图访问一个不存在的文件或目录时会触发此错误。 基础概念 errno 是Linux 系统中的一个全局变量,用于表示最近一次系统调用或库函数调用发生的错误类型。每个错误类型都有一个唯一的数字表示,errno ...